首页 | 本学科首页   官方微博 | 高级检索  
     

基于多agent的程序理解方法研究
引用本文:王少锋. 基于多agent的程序理解方法研究[J]. 计算机科学, 2002, 29(5): 131-133
作者姓名:王少锋
作者单位:清华大学计算机科学与技术系,北京,100084
摘    要:一、引言软件逆向工程的研究是软件工程领域的一个重要而实用的研究内容。逆向工程是在给定源代码的情况下理解软件结构的一个途径,其目的是标识软件系统中的构造块,抽取结构依赖关系,为系统创造另一种更高抽象形式的表示。软件逆向工程是基于以下的假设:构造软件系统的过程是从问题域到实现域的映射过程,这种映射是在正向工程中完成的,而且也是一个可逆的过程,可以在不同的抽象级别上被重构。程序理解是软件逆向工程的一个重要组成部分,程序理解技术的研究具有广阔的应用前景:如1)对软件复用的支持,用于标识可复用的软构件;2)对软件测试的支持,有助于选择测试用例;3)用于设计验证和错误检测等;4)对软件维护的支

关 键 词:软件工程 软件逆向工程 软件复用 程序理解 Agent

On A Multi-agent based Program Understanding Theory and Methods
Abstract:
Keywords:
本文献已被 CNKI 维普 万方数据 等数据库收录!
点击此处可从《计算机科学》下载全文
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号